Object documentationPartners (Involved Parties)

 

Relationships between an Intellectual Property and a business partner are displayed as product relationship and displayed using the Involved Parties relationship type.

 

You maintain a relationship between an Intellectual Property and a business partner to:

  • Document this relationship in the system

  • The relationship can also be read during partner determination in the contract. To do so, make the settings in Customizing for Customer Relationship Management by choosing Start of the navigation path Basic Functions Next navigation step Partner Processing Next navigation step Business Add-In for Partner End of the navigation path.

Structure

To link a business partner with the Intellectual Property using partner functions, you must make the following Customizing settings first:

  • Define the corresponding partner functions under: Start of the navigation path Customer Relationship Management Next navigation step Basic Functions Next navigation step Partner Processing Next navigation step Define Partner Functions End of the navigation path.

  • Group these partner functions in a partner determination procedure under: Start of the navigation path Customer Relationship Management Next navigation step Basic Functions Next navigation step Partner Processing Next navigation step Define Partner Determination Procedure End of the navigation path.

  • You then assign this partner determination procedure to a basis category of the Intellectual Property type in the SAP Easy Access menu under: Start of the navigation path Master Data Next navigation step Products Next navigation step Maintain Categories and Hierarchies. End of the navigation path
